How Many Hashtags Should You Use?
The optimal number varies by platform:
| Platform | Optimal Hashtags | Notes |
|----------|-----------------|-------|
| Instagram | 20-30 | Use all available slots |
| Twitter/X | 1-3 | More than 3 reduces engagement |
| LinkedIn | 3-5 | Quality over quantity |
| TikTok | 3-5 | Mix broad and niche tags |
| YouTube | 3-5 | Include one broad and one specific |
| Facebook | 1-3 | Minimal hashtag use recommended |
The key isn't just quantity — it's relevance. Using 30 irrelevant hashtags hurts more than using 5 perfect ones.
Types of Hashtags
Broad Hashtags
These have millions of posts: #writing, #marketing, #technology. They give you visibility but also massive competition. Your content gets buried within seconds.
Niche Hashtags
These target specific communities: #writingtips, #contentstrategy, #textcleaner. Fewer posts mean more visibility. Your content stays relevant longer.
Branded Hashtags
Your unique hashtag: #txttools. Use branded hashtags consistently to build recognition and create a content archive.
Trending Hashtags
Time-sensitive tags based on current events. Use sparingly and only when relevant. Irrelevant trending tags harm your credibility.

Hashtag Strategy by Platform
Instagram allows up to 30 hashtags per post. Use them all, but strategically. Create sets of hashtags for different content types. Store them in a notes app for quick copy-paste.
Twitter / X
Twitter's 280-character limit means hashtags compete with your message. Use 1-3 highly relevant tags. Place them at the end of your tweet or inline if they fit naturally.
LinkedIn rewards professional, specific hashtags. #DigitalMarketing is better than #Marketing. Use hashtags in your content body, not just at the end.
TikTok
TikTok's algorithm relies heavily on hashtags for content discovery. Use a mix of trending and niche tags. Include #fyp or #foryou for broader reach.
Hashtag Mistakes to Avoid
**Using banned hashtags.** Some hashtags are shadow-banned by platforms. Using them hides your content from search results.
**Overstuffing.** Using 30 hashtags on Twitter looks spammy and reduces engagement. Follow platform-specific best practices.
**Irrelevant tags.** #Food on a tech article might get views, but it won't get engagement from your target audience.
**Never changing your set.** Audience interests and trending topics change. Update your hashtag sets regularly.
